Gay Pride, also called LGBTQ pride, is an annual festivity that celebrates the love, diversity, acceptance, and pride of the lesbian, gay, bisexual, transgender, and queer community. PRIDE is an acronym for Personal Rights in Defense and Education. 

The history of Gay Pride encourages and embraces individuality and self-worth. Gay Pride origin stems from the Stonewall riots of 1969, which was the turning point for the Gay Liberation Movement in the United States. On June 28, 1969, police raided the Stonewall Inn bar in Manhattan. They were met with opposition when patrons of the Stonewall, other local lesbian and gay bars, and neighborhood members fought back as the police became violent. This sparked several days of riots and demonstrations, and is considered to be one of the biggest events in the fight for LGBTQ rights in the US.

One of the attendees of the riots was Marsha P. Johnson, a trans woman and drag queen, who one year later on the first anniversary of the riots, marched in the first Gay Pride rally. Every June, Gay Pride celebrations commemorate the anniversary of the Stonewall riots and the major role it played in gay rights activism. 

The Gay Pride movement was coordinated by Brenda Howard, also known as the “Mother of Pride,” who put in motion the very first LGBTQ Pride march, as well as the inception of Pride Day. These events then transformed into the annual LGBTQ Pride celebrations we know and love today.

Where and When Is Pride Month Celebrated? 

In many cities, the month of June is synonymous with Gay Pride. Some cities celebrate one weekend of June, while other locations hold month-long festivities. Some U.S presidents, including Barack Obama, have even officially declared June as LGBT Pride Month. While the origins stem from the United States, Pride celebrations are held globally, including in cities like Amsterdam, Paris, Mexico City, São Paulo, and London. Pride events usually see several hundred thousand to more than a million attendants annually. In 2007, it was estimated that Europride in Madrid had more than two million celebrants in attendance!

How Is Pride Month Celebrated?

The types of festivities that take place during Pride month can vary from city to city. From parades and marches to parties and symposiums to workshops and concerts, Pride celebrations are celebrated in a variety of forms. Some participants choose to celebrate in a rambunctiously joyous fashion while others prefer to attend massive rallies or community forums for a more toned down, educational experience. Whichever way you choose to participate, Pride celebrations encompass positive self-affirmation, equal rights, and a community of diversity. Some locations also hold memorials for members of the LGBTQ community who have since passed on.

The Rainbow Flag
The rainbow flag is a quintessential symbol of the LGBTQ community and a major component to Pride celebrations. San Francisco artist Gilbert Baker designed the flag in 1978 and debuted it at a Pride event in San Francisco. Since then, the rainbow flag has become the symbol for the LGBTQ political movement and community and is still prominently displayed throughout Pride month and permanently throughout some LGBTQ communities. Pride participants often dress in rainbow attire or carry rainbow flags during the festivities. 

According to Baker, each color of the LGBTQ flag represents a different meaning: 

  • Red for life
  • Orange for healing
  • Yellow for the sun
  • Green for nature
  • Blue for harmony
  • Violet for spirit
